WebNext, calculate your useable equity. Banks are generally comfortable lending up to 80% of the value of your home, minus the amount you owe to the bank. In our example, 80% of $750,000 is $600,000, so the useable equity is $200,000. You may be able to leverage this equity in your home as a deposit on an investment property. WebEquity is the current market value of your home minus the amount you owe on your mortgage. It grows as you pay down your mortgage and as your home increases in value. … WebApr 10, 2024 · Let’s say your home is valued at $250,000 and you still have $150,000 to pay off on your mortgage, your home equity would be $100,000. If you are up for doing the math, here’s a quick equation to help you find your home equity: Home Value – Remaining Mortgage Principal = Home Equity. As you pay down your mortgage and if your home …
